Definition of psalm:

(n) : a sacred song; a poetical composition for use in the praise or worship of God; especially, one of the hymns by David and others, collected into one book of the Old Testament, or a modern metrical version of such a hymn for public worship
(v) : to extol in psalms; to sing; as, psalming his praises
